Instant Halloween

Of course, I had to take photos of the trick-or-treaters when they came to our house, begging for candy. Of course, I had to ask parents (when available) for permission to take photos of their kids. And, of course, I did “one-for-you-one-for-me” instant photos, because…well…that’s my thang, my groove, my schtick, my oeuvre, my modus operandi…

This year, in what seemed like a post-pandemic release of creative energy — or just a pent-up desire to have some fun — all the adults I saw were in costume! Sadly, some of the “grown up” outfits were far better than those worn by their own children. On social media, it seemed as if all the celebrities were donning serious costumes and makeup this year, which also seemed like busting loose after the pandemic.

We didn’t dress up or go out this year. We just waited patiently for the mad ringing of our doorbell by sugar-fueled and sugar-hungry little index fingers, attached to the greedy, grabbing hands of young people, blissfully unaware that we heard the very first ring of the doorbell, which rendered all subsequent rings unnecessary and annoying AF… But it was fun nevertheless! Here’s a few of the instant photos I took this year:
